**Mgmt Meeting Minutes — Retiring the Brightline Range**

Quick recap for sales leads at Fenholt Supplies: we agreed to retire the Brightline fixture range by year-end. Remaining stock moves to clearance pricing next month, and accounts on standing orders get migrated to the Lumetta range. Trade-in incentives were approved in principle. The confidential note on next steps sits just below.

board note of bajof-bajeg: The pricing group signed off on a budget of $13.4 million for Project Sildor. The renewal with Lamixek Holdings closes at $48.9 million a year, 49 percent above the last contract.

# Break-Glass: SplitRoute Assignment Service

Use break-glass only if SplitRoute stops assigning experiment arms and both admins are unreachable. Page the duty lead first. Log the incident number before touching anything. The emergency console accepts one attempt per ten minutes; three failures lock the service for an hour. When prompted by the console, enter the recovery passphrase that follows.

strongbox words: sorir-belvan-rusix-ulays-ralmir-praix-eliir-tamax-praael-druael-julir-tamius-jorir

FAQ: How do I upgrade my plugin for Quillbus 4? Quillbus 4 replaces the legacy fanout API with typed channels, so plugin authors must recompile against the new SDK and declare channel schemas explicitly. Old-style consumers keep working for one release cycle, then fail at registration. If your plugin's migration sandbox locks you out mid-upgrade, restore access with the recovery passphrase that follows.

unlock words, tahof-kawip: eliath-sorix-wenius

Migration Step 4: Enable Offline Mode (Fernhollow Surveyor)

Upgrade clients to 3.2 before flipping the flag. Offline capture queues survey entries locally and syncs when connectivity returns; conflict resolution is last-write-wins per field. Purge stale local caches first or sync will reject mixed-schema batches. Roll out region by region. Apply the following configuration to each deployment.

deployment values, hawep-hawep:
RALAX_PIN=0900
RALAX_TENANT=sildor
RALAX_METRICS_HOST=metrics.ralax.xolmardata.example
RALAX_SEAL=seal_87e42d77
RALAX_STANDBY_TEAM=briius